Heavyweight Action: Seth Mitchell vs. Timur Ibragimov, Saturday December 10th

Seth “Mayhem” Mitchell (23-0-1, 17KOs) will meet Timur Ibragimov (30-3-1, 16KOs) in a heavyweight co-featured bout to Amir Khan vs. Lamont Peterson this Saturday, December 10th.

In a division that at times lacks excitement, Mitchell is an exciting prospect fight fans are interested in seeing.  After several knee injuries ended his football career at Michigan State University, Mitchell graduated and then took up boxing in 2006.  Since 2010, Mitchell has fought eight times and won every bout by knockout.  His HBO debut Saturday will be an important test for Mitchell as he faces an experienced fighter on a big stage.

Ibragimov has won nine of his last ten bouts, three of those by knockout.  He is coming off a SD loss to Jean-Marc Mormeck.  His other two losses on record come against Tony Thompson and Calvin Brock.  Ibragimov knows that to face elite competition, a win Saturday is imperative.

The bout will take place at the Walter E. Washington Convention Center in Washington D.C. and will be televised live on HBO’s World Championship Boxing.  The telecast will begin at 9:45pm ET.
